ECO Latest Report
Financial Performance
Based on the provided data, Okeanis Eco Tankers' total operating revenue decreased by RMB6,481,000, or approximately 7.07%, from RMB91,670,520 in 2023 to RMB85,189,520 in 2024 as of December 31. This change may reflect challenges faced by the company in terms of market demand, operational efficiency, or competitive environment. While the overall shipping industry is expected to see revenue growth, the decline in Okeanis Eco Tankers' revenue indicates specific issues it is facing.
